The US Dollar Index measures the dollar's value against a basket of six foreign currencies: the Euro, Japanese Yen, British Pound, Canadian Dollar, Swedish Krona, and Swiss Franc. It’s a vital economic indicator, reflecting how strong the dollar is in the foreign exchange markets.
